Does anybody know a mobile phone which I can connect to a rooftop antenna? Since I got no signal in a issan village this would be the only solution.

My siemens phone (c35i) which I use in europe has such a connection at the backside but unfortunately this phone can not be "chipped or tuned" in bangkok.

I disagree with the car kit option as there is no signal prevalent and the car kit does not allow you to point the ariel in the direction of the nearest cell (Which must be within 13 miles (@20km) or you can forget it anyway!)

- better to spend a little more cash and get a decent tv size ariel. I put one on a 60 foot pole and now have 5 bar signal instead of the occaisional 1/2 bar.

thanks for the replies. On my mororola phone I use right now something like a inductionloop (don't know the right word) which I can slip over the antenna of my phone and than connect it to the roofantenna. I went from a no signal to a 2 bar signal but during rain the signal is again zero.

@AussieDoug: I also think the car kit is no solution. I had to point my roofantenna (or ariel) in the excact direction of the next cell.

If it is the GSM system you better check the distance to the nearest antenna before you purchase a large roof top antenna. The theoretical maximum distance for a GSM connection is approximately 35 km.
